Submission for ABIM MOC Credit Using the GRS6 CD-ROM

The fully revised Geriatrics Review Syllabus: A Core Curriculum in Geriatric Medicine, Sixth Edition (GRS6) contains the latest developments in geriatric medicine for those who wish to expand and update their knowledge in the field.

The GRS6 is available as a 3-volume book package and/or as a CD-ROM edition.

The GRS6 program is authored by more than 100 medical experts on the care of older persons. This comprehensive review of geriatric medicine is composed of:

  • 59 chapters (including 168 tables and 42 figures) covering the prevailing management strategies and recent findings in five broad areas of geriatric medicine
  • Annotated references that allow the interested reader to pursue topics in greater depth
  • An extensive appendix with assessment instruments and practical resources
  • 263 case-oriented multiple-choice questions with answers, critiques, and references, providing an effective, valuable self-assessment tool

The GRS6 is:

  • a convenient self-assessment program - Clinicians who use the GRS6' self-assessment features can earn a maximum of 75 Continuing Medical Education (CME) credits through the American Medical Association (AMA), up to 75 Prescribed credits from the American Academy of Family Physicians (AAFP), and up to 75 hours in Category 2-B of AOA CME from the American Osteopathic Association (AOA).
  • a way to earn 100 lifelong learning points for those enrolled in the ABIM Maintenance of Certification program (through the GRS6 CD-ROM edition)
  • a concise, up-to-date, and comprehensive reference on geriatric medicine
  • the authoritative source for those preparing to take board examinations including the Certificate of Added Qualifications in Geriatric Medicine
  • an excellent teaching resource
